時間:2023-07-25|瀏覽:295
2020年12月21日,BitGo托管的數(shù)字資產(chǎn)達到了160億美元。
可以看到BitGo最開始是做工具起家的,在2013年數(shù)字資產(chǎn)僅僅只有很少的人在使用,基本上都是用的原生的錢包比如BitcoinCore。大多數(shù)使用BitcoinCore的用戶使用的地址都是單簽,而多重簽名還需要一些配套的服務,比如簽名地址的創(chuàng)建、待簽名交易的提醒等,這一點上BitcoinCore無法提供。
隨著BTC等數(shù)字資產(chǎn)價格的上漲,傳統(tǒng)投資機構(gòu)的目光開始投向數(shù)字資產(chǎn)領域,但在美國機構(gòu)投資都需要第三方的托管,比如證券公司一般都要跟銀行合作將客戶的錢托管在銀行,這個時候推出數(shù)字資產(chǎn)托管服務也就順理成章了。
那么WBTC的推出又是什么原因呢?BTC不是有息資產(chǎn),持有BTC除了享受BTC價格上漲帶來的收益外沒有其它收益,這點跟黃金一樣。
隨著Defi的發(fā)展產(chǎn)生了很多借貸、衍生品交易項目,這些項目很多都需要ETH作為抵押資產(chǎn),而抵押的好處就是能有額外收益,比如借貸的利息。2019年開始火起來的流動性挖礦更是給抵押操作帶來了很多的有息收益,因此BTC進入以太坊參與Defi項目獲取有息收益的需求就出來了。
WBTC架構(gòu)設計如下圖所示:
Custodian是BTC的托管者,目前只有BitGo是Custodian。
Merchant是做市商,負責向普通用戶銷售和回收WBTC。
Customer是普通的WBTC使用者。
Custodian只跟Merchant打交道,而Merchant跟很多個普通用戶打交道,因此有點批發(fā)與零售的意思。除了上述三個角色之外還有個WBTCDAOmember這個角色,負責以太坊上部分合約的管理工作。
BitGo是WBTC架構(gòu)中唯一的Custodian,它負責BTC多重簽名地址的生成和管理。Custodian會給每個Merchant生成一個對應的BTC地址,Merchant往該地址轉(zhuǎn)入了BTC之后才能執(zhí)行在以太坊合約上的WBTC鑄造流程。比如BitGo給CoinList這個Merchant分配的地址是3ErNFK17MbH3GAGfakMwTrKo8uHmBuuVX1,給imToken分配的地址是34MSicAL7qVGkevFPLwyc9KohGzoUSnu3Q。
想當Merchant需要跟BitGo去申請,然后跟BitGo簽合同,合同中會約定Merchant鑄造和銷毀WBTC的費率。Merchant需要負責給Customer進行KYC和AML,Merchant同樣可以對Customer進行收費,同時WBTC的流行能給Merchant帶來更多的流量。這種批發(fā)零售制度對BitGo來說一是可以省去大量Customer的KYC和AML工作,二是可以通過Merchant的渠道將WBTC銷售給更多的Customer。
WBTC的鑄造分為兩個階段,第一階段是Merchant將BTC轉(zhuǎn)移到Custodian分配的充值地址上,第二階段是Merchant在以太坊上發(fā)起鑄造流程。
鑄造流程如上圖所示:
第一步,Merchant初始化一個Mint請求,請求格式如下:
比如CoinList的一次Mint請求參數(shù)如下
amount:54978000000
btcTxid:3bfad1f903f359bd72053322ed1565a832071c6712850971c90030fd1a81f1e3
btcDepositAddress:3ErNFK17MbH3GAGfakMwTrKo8uHmBuuVX1
也即是鑄造549.78個WBTC,而實際